Small but Mighty: 22 Years of Youth Grief Programs Offering Hope and Healing
For 22 years, The Mark Wandall Foundation has been a place of hope and comfort for children, teens, and young adults in Florida who have experienced the death of a parent, sibling, or guardian. The Mark Wandall Foundation Receives Grant…
Wendy Orlando and Kathy Westhoff accept a $500 grant from the Sisterhood For Good Fund One and Two of the Manatee Community Foundation on July 29, 2015. The Mark Wandall Foundation is most grateful for their support.
